Position Title: CTE Administrative Assistant
Supervisor: Director for CTE
Term of Employment: 12 months
Salary Classification: 13
Job Summary: Performs a variety of moderate administrative and secretarial support functions for the CTE department.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ES Generally Include The Following
- Performs a variety of clerical and secretarial functions as needed in the position to support the PUSD CTE Strategic Plan, its programs, and the leadership team, including placing, screening & forwarding telephone calls
- Schedules a variety of meetings, conferences, interviews, in-services, workshops, and other activities
- Arranges meeting sites and handles logistical requirements. Makes travel arrangements as needed
- Prepares agendas, presentations, and informational packets for the department
- Coordinates the CTE department calendar
- Maintains department's portal, website, and social media for regular communication with both internal and external stakeholders
- Coordinates a variety of ad hoc or special projects
- Maintains, updates, and creates files, records, and databases for assigned programs or department
- Schedules employment interviews and conducts reference checks for department
- Maintains and edits timesheets for department
- Maintains, updates, and creates files, records, and databases for the CTE department, including, CTE advisory board members, CTE teacher certification, and CTE stipend tracking & inventory tracking
- Processes and monitors a variety of agreements, contraction and applications within the CTE dept.
- Performs other duties as assigned or required.

Minimum Qualifications
A High School Diploma or GED, AND two (2) years of administrative and secretarial experience in a professional office; OR any equivalent combination of experience and/or education from which comparable knowledge, skills and abilities have been achieved.
Other Requirements
- Must be able to pass a fingerprint and background clearance check.
- Must be able to work outside normal working hours.
- May be required to possess and maintain a valid Arizona driver's license
